Chemical Research Technician- Trevose PA
Are you eager to be at the cutting edge of innovation in water treatment solutions? Our laboratory partner, located in Bensalem, PA, is seeking a motivated and dynamic individual to join our team as a Chemical Research Technician.
Key Responsibilities:

  • Innovative Solutions: Lead research and development initiatives to create advanced chemical solutions for our valued clients, driving improvements in water treatment performance and ensuring a competitive edge in the industry.
  • Collaborative Development: Partner with the development team to brainstorm, experiment, and analyze results. Your contributions will be essential in shaping the future of water treatment technologies.
  • Project Execution: Utilize your scientific expertise to design, analyze, and evaluate projects while maintaining a focus on business standards and project timelines. You will play a key role in achieving project milestones and ensuring successful execution.
  • Customer-Centric Support: Provide technical assistance and problem-solving expertise to customers in the industrial water sector, addressing their needs effectively and fostering customer satisfaction and loyalty.
Qualifications:
  • Educational Background: Bachelor's Degree in Science (Chemistry, Materials Science, Chemical Engineering, Biochemistry, Integrated Science and Technology).
  • Experience: Less than 3 years of industrial chemistry experience.
Desired Skills and Attributes:
  • Specialized Knowledge: Experience with wet analytical techniques (e.g., titrations and chemical analyses) is highly advantageous.
  • Mechanical Aptitude: Basic mechanical skills, including the ability to work with tools for piping and fittings, are a plus.
  • Interpersonal Skills: Strong communication skills paired with exceptional interpersonal abilities are essential. You should thrive in a collaborative, fast-paced work environment.
  • Problem-Solving Skills: Demonstrated ability to conceptualize and solve complex problems while implementing creative and innovative solutions.
  • Safety First: A commitment to maintaining strong environmental, health, and safety standards in all aspects of work.
  • Passion for Excellence: Driven by a passion for quality, speed, and continuous improvement, with a relentless pursuit of excellence in all aspects of your work.
